I had someone put a footlong vertical dent in my passenger side door when my car was only a few months old. It almost seemed intentional. I try to park as far away as possible from other cars, but there's ALWAYS some moron in his hooptie parked right snug next to my car when I come back to it! Anyways, my dent cost $275 to get out, but it's as if it was never there. As long as the paintwork is not compromised a PDR shop can do some pretty amazing work. Most going rates are $75 for a quarter-sized dent, so you can guesstimate for larger ones. $100 for a panel full of dings is low, but would be accurate for a 1.5-inch ding.

Dr. Colorchip makes a pretty good product for small dings and chips. The paint matches my palladium 100%, and the small stone chips that that I've covered with it are not visible from one foot away.
